A "Guide to Home Wiring PDF" is essentially a digital manual designed to demystify the complex world of residential electrical systems. It typically covers a wide range of topics, starting with the fundamental principles of electricity and progressing to practical applications within the home. You'll find explanations of circuit breakers, grounding, different types of wire gauges, and how to safely connect outlets and switches. The importance of understanding these basics cannot be overstated; it's crucial for preventing electrical hazards and ensuring your home's electrical system functions reliably and safely.

Furthermore, a well-structured "Guide to Home Wiring PDF" will often feature visual aids to make complex concepts easier to grasp. These can include diagrams, schematics, and photographic examples of proper installation. Some guides even incorporate tables that help you identify the correct wire size for different circuits or understand voltage drop calculations. For instance, a basic table might look like this:

Appliance/Device Typical Wattage Recommended Breaker Size (Amps) Minimum Wire Gauge (AWG)
Light Fixture (Standard) 60-100W 15A 14 AWG
Standard Outlet Circuit Varies 20A 12 AWG
